This may be correctly implemented, but when tuning FM range, programable frequencies start at 31.00 mhz.  My question is should the radio be able to tune 30.0mhz and up instead of starting at 31?  If it is accurate, it is what it is, but right now many FM mission frequencies are 30.00mhz by default and therefore unusable in Av8b.  

 

To summarize, should it be possible to tune 30.00mhz in the harrier?
